This audiobook summary offers an accessible overview of John Doerr’s concept of OKRs (Objectives and Key Results), highlighting their practical application for achieving professional goals. It features chapter summaries, real-world success stories, and key insights to help listeners understand and implement the goal-setting system effectively. Please note, this is a companion to the original book, providing a concise and engaging exploration of the methodology.
